On 26 February 2026, in Serie A, Gremio FB Porto Alegrense pressed to secure a 2-1 home win against Atletico MG. The opener arrived at 50:22 in the second half, giving Gremio a slender lead that Atletico MG quickly cancelled at 55:59. Gremio answered decisively with a second at 65:46 to edge clear for the final result.

Gremio deployed a higher set-piece volume, delivering six corners to Atletico MG’s three, signaling greater attacking intent from wide areas. The offside figures show Gremio tested the line twice while Atletico MG did not be caught offside, suggesting the home side targeted through-balls and runs in behind the backline more aggressively.

Fouls leaned in Gremio’s favour in the sense of physical pressure, with 12 committed by the home side versus 7 by the visitors. Gremio collected four yellow cards to Atletico MG’s zero, reflecting a combative approach that kept the tempo high. The red card awarded to Atletico MG altered the balance, reducing their counter options and disrupting their structure for the remainder of the match.

Attacking pacing favoured the home team after halftime, as the lead was restored in the mid-to-late stage of the second half to clinch the victory. Atletico MG’s numerical disadvantage constrained their ability to engineer sustained pressure, limiting any late equaliser despite their efforts in the final phases. The sequence of goals demonstrates Gremio’s capacity to respond to setbacks with immediate, goal-producing intensity.

Teamwork and tactical balance mattered here, with Gremio maintaining structure while deploying width to stretch Atletico MG’s defense. The home side’s greater willingness to probe from set-pieces and keep the ball in wide areas helped them control phases of the game after going ahead. Atletico MG appeared to struggle to cohesively link play under pressure and to convert chances when in offensive spurts.
